The new funding includes a $15.5 million Series A-1 round led by Monte\u2019s Fam and a $15 million venture loan from Horizon Technology Finance.<\/p>\n<p><span id=\"more-417789\"\/><\/p>\n<p>Founded in 2017, SparkCharge says it operates the largest off-grid EV charging network for fleets in the world. Its core service \u2013 Charging-as-a-Service (CaaS) \u2013 lets commercial fleets access DC fast charging without waiting months for permits or dealing with expensive construction. Instead, SparkCharge delivers flexible, mobile, or off-grid charging solutions that can be deployed instantly \u2013 no grid access needed.<\/p>\n<p>The fresh funding announced last week will go toward growing SparkCharge\u2019s customer base, expanding its coverage across North America, and rolling out new strategic partnerships. \u201cThis raise reflects both the strength of the SparkCharge growth story as well as the market opportunity ahead as electric fleets become the standard for so many prominent brands,\u201d said CEO and founder Josh Aviv. \u201cWe\u2019re focused on removing the anxiety, guesswork, and delays \u2013\u00a0all still barriers for adoption \u2013 out of the commercial EV charging experience.\u201d<\/p>\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"h-how-sparkcharge-s-off-grid-charging-works\">How SparkCharge\u2019s off-grid charging works<\/h3>\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image alignwide size-large\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"1300\" height=\"650\" src=\"https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-CaaS.jpg?quality=82&amp;strip=all&amp;w=1024\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-417792\" srcset=\"https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-CaaS.jpg 1300w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-CaaS.jpg?resize=150,75 150w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-CaaS.jpg?resize=300,150 300w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-CaaS.jpg?resize=768,384 768w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-CaaS.jpg?resize=1024,512 1024w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-CaaS.jpg?resize=350,175 350w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-CaaS.jpg?resize=140,70 140w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-CaaS.jpg?resize=290,145 290w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1300px) 100vw, 1300px\"\/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">SparkCharge mobile battery charging Photo: SparkCharge<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p>SparkCharge offers three scalable solutions to help fleets go electric quickly:<\/p>\n<p>\t<span class=\"outbrain-ad-label\">Advertisement &#8211; scroll for more content<\/span><\/p>\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Mobile battery charging:<\/strong> An 80\u2013300 kW battery-powered fast charger that\u2019s deployable on demand. Fleets can choose white glove service, self-management, or a hybrid service.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Off-grid power hub:<\/strong> A 180\u2013500 kW clean energy-powered microgrid fast charger that can juice up multiple EVs at once.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Permanent EV Infrastructure:<\/strong> A turnkey setup that starts with mobile and off-grid and scales to a permanent, grid-connected system. SparkCharge handles everything from permits to construction.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>SparkCharge\u2019s charging network is already live in all 50 states. It recently became the EV Charging Partner for the 2025 Masters Tournament and launched a partnership with electrical equipment maker Pioneer Power. To date, the company says it has delivered over 4 million kWh of energy and displaced more than 500,000 gallons of gasoline.<\/p>\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image alignwide size-large\"><img loading=\"lazy\" lo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1284\" height=\"700\" src=\"https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-Microgrid_3.jpg?quality=82&amp;strip=all&amp;w=1024\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-417794\" srcset=\"https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-Microgrid_3.jpg 1284w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-Microgrid_3.jpg?resize=150,82 150w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-Microgrid_3.jpg?resize=300,164 300w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-Microgrid_3.jpg?resize=768,419 768w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-Microgrid_3.jpg?resize=1024,558 1024w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-Microgrid_3.jpg?resize=350,191 350w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/SparkCharge-Microgrid_3.jpg?resize=140,76 140w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1284px) 100vw, 1284px\"\/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">SparkCharge microgrid Photo: SparkCharge<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p>CFO David Piperno added that the company has also secured non-dilutive financing with CSC Leasing to keep equipment flowing as demand grows.<\/p>\n<p>The SparkCharge model lands at a time when demand for commercial EVs is climbing fast. According to Cox Automotive, 87% of fleet managers expect to add EVs in the next five years, but access to charging remains the biggest barrier. SparkCharge bypasses that bottleneck entirely.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cSparkCharge\u2019s mobile, off-grid charging solutions effectively solve this challenge by bringing power directly to vehicles when and where it\u2019s needed,\u201d said Ed Jean-Louis, CEO of lead investor Monte\u2019s Fam.<\/p>\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image alignwide size-full\"><a href=\"https:\/\/www.energysage.com\/landing\/home-solar\/p\/electrek-rsm-ml\/?utm_medium=Partner&amp;utm_source=Electrek\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\"><img loading=\"lazy\" lo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"750\" height=\"150\" src=\"https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/DES-1038_Electrek-Banners_Resiliency_b5668c.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-417796\" srcset=\"https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/DES-1038_Electrek-Banners_Resiliency_b5668c.png 750w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/DES-1038_Electrek-Banners_Resiliency_b5668c.png?resize=150,30 150w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/DES-1038_Electrek-Banners_Resiliency_b5668c.png?resize=300,60 300w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/DES-1038_Electrek-Banners_Resiliency_b5668c.png?resize=350,70 350w, https:\/\/electrek.co\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/3\/2025\/05\/DES-1038_Electrek-Banners_Resiliency_b5668c.png?resize=140,28 140w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 750px) 100vw, 750px\"\/><\/a><\/figure>\n<p><strong>Read more:<\/strong> <a href=\"https:\/\/electrek.co\/2025\/05\/20\/waffle-house-dc-fast-chargers-bp-pulse\/\">Waffle House is getting DC fast chargers \u2013 and it\u2019s a genius move<\/a><\/p>\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n<p><em>Now is a great time to begin your solar journey so your system is installed in time for those longer sunny days.
